Re: lsd diff work with sr5 axles?
no, theyre a smaller diameter, youll need a full gts rear. FYI, zenki and kouki axles are different diameters as well. the lengths from open to lsd are different too, I believe you can shorten an open axle to fit the lsd, but I would recommend searching for that length info, im not 100% on the which...

Re: 4AGE Rebuilt, Before First Start Questions
if the pump isn't turning on, check the multi wire ground that is under the #2 injector. it has about 4 brown with black trace wires going to the loop. it bolts to the intake manifold. that grounds injectors and afm.
